Alliance for Historical Dialogue and Accountability (AHDA) Fellowship
Merit Based
Fellowship
United States of America
Provided by Columbia University
Eligibility Criteria
- Mid-career professionals working on issues related to dealing with the past, such as transitional justice, historical dialogue, memory studies, historical justice, oral history, and history education.
- Demonstrated ability to pursue graduate-level studies.
- Applicants should be mid-career professionals with full or part-time jobs pursuing advocacy efforts. Full-time students are not considered.
- Fellows must work in the country and/or region where they live. Fluency in English is required.

Scholarship Benefits
- Funding Coverage:
- Tuition for all program-related coursework.
- Travel expenses to and from New York City.
- Housing accommodations during the fellowship period.
- Modest stipend to cover living expenses.
- Duration of Funding:
- Covers the entire duration of the fall semester fellowship program.
